Polyolefin materials are available with different characteristics, including cross-linked wrap that provides high-tensile strength and incredible clarity for high-speed packaging applications. Stretch wraps are commonly used throughout different warehouses and distribution centers to wrap pallets of products for storage and or shipment. Shrink wraps can be formed into flattened roll stock, bags, overwrap, banding, and tubing, and add a form of tamper-resistant protection to packaged goods. There are multiple forms that PE can take, but the three most common would be Low-Density Polyethylene (LDPE), Linear Low-Density Polyethylene (LLDPE), & High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E).

Polyolefin shrink wrap has excellent puncture resistance and seal strength, allowing for irregular-shaped items to have excellent protection throughout their supply chain life-cycle. Stretch wrap is a stretchable plastic that is wrapped tightly around a load of products. The material known as shrink wrap is a clear plastic wrap that is used to package millions of products around the world.
